Output 8e510cc19e9fde1d49ab7b6fa0fc7423c90f59d51070c38d4ac35ee8ddbed580:1

value
657000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a83151a817ff875e8e346932011ac4efb69e686 OP_EQUAL
address
3QXbtGY2ca9CzZQPQ8isfkvZsf91vYgNV2
transaction
8e510cc19e9fde1d49ab7b6fa0fc7423c90f59d51070c38d4ac35ee8ddbed580
spent
true